I'm building a new rig shortly and as I can't afford the gear that's just been released nor is it possible to wait for new stuff coming out (If I did, I'd never get to upgrade)

So I intend to build the following...

AMD 64 Bit 4000 cpu (single core for now)
Asus A8N-SLI mobo
Corsair matched ram
Nvidia 7800 graphics card (just one for now)
600Watt PSU
Case (made from lego)

Since todays games are not yet fully dual core compatable I'm going for the single core option to start with, the mobo will support both single and dual core cpu's so later in the year when the prices have fallen again, I'll upgrade to a dual core cpu.

Like wise with the graphics card, what I consider to be the best present day one, then later buy another and run them in SLI mode.

I know what you are all thinking and we all have our own preferences, personally my route is AMD/Nvidia, others will choose different.

The point being, if you wait for quad cores or DDR2 memory or the next generation of graphics card, you'll never upgrade, unless you've got pots of money.

Just my thoughts...

Dude, while you'll get a bunch of good suggestions on building your own rig, if you just want to a real good perfomer without screwdriver time involved, here's what I did.....went down to CompUSA and located a nice Gateway rig they had with a fast CPU, lotsa fast memory, and a big hard drive. And a pukey, low-end vid card. That bit was like, $800 or more, don't recall.

Then I bought an ATI Radeon PCI Express XL800 video card - lotsa memory, great specs. That was like, $350 at the time or somethin'. Put the card in myself which doesn't void the warranty.

That was about it. I ended up with a warranty, a fresh Windows XP install with service pack 2 out of the box, all the support you can eat, tons of free HD space (you DO have to reinstall your old programs).

The only thing I didn't get was my old data, documents, files transferred over and THAT is the key part. I had two fully-running computers tho, so I hooked 'em together with a crossover network cable and configured a littel private network so they could see each other, and pumped the data files andsuch over that way. But you DO want to justdo a re-install one the actual programs themselves, so they configure properly to yoru new hardware and windows registry is proper, all that. When you see folks pump CFS3, IL2 or FS2004 over in whole doing a data transfer, that's when problems seem to start. But the data files they use should make the trip OK.

There maybe other, better ways to do that (and if you can only run in safe mode, networking is not an option for you I believe) and comments on that bit would probably be appreciated....anyway, hardware-wise, not wanting to fuss around with cases, mobos, memory, drivers, and all that, (I can, but my time is more important to me) I went out the door easily under your price goal.....actually I had enough left over to get me a big ol' 19 or 20" CRT monitor and was still under 1500 I believe.....runs like a striped-@ss ape, tons of FPS, and rock solid.

And if any little burp or something happens I don't have to worry that it was my 'puter-building skills or parts choice.....
